FAQ — Facilities Desk, Oastermill Campus. Q: How do staff get into the bike cage and through the parking gates? A: Both use the same reader network. Standard badges open the parking gates on Linden Row between 06:00 and 21:00. The bike cage behind Block C requires cycle-scheme registration first; allow two working days. Out of hours, the gates run in restricted mode and reject standard badges. For desk staff handling out-of-hours requests, issue the shared gate code below.

staff pass of kawip-hawef = bdg-QLP-2

Handover note — Crumbwheel order cutoffs.

Welcome aboard. The bakery cutoff rule in Crumbwheel closes same-day orders at 14:00 local to each storefront, not UTC — this has bitten us twice. Holiday overrides live in the calendar service and take precedence silently, so always check there first when a cutoff looks wrong. To unlock the calendar service's admin console after a restart, enter the recovery passphrase below.

vault phrase of bagap-bahaf = silion-pelox-sorox-casdor-quenwyn-fraax-eliox-praael-kelion-quenvan-kasox-rusael-norius-belvan

Facilities ticket — Night shift, Brindlecote Campus. Twenty-two interns from the Fennhollow programme arrive tomorrow at 08:00. Please unlock seminar rooms B2 and B3 by 06:30, set chairs to classroom layout, and confirm the water coolers on level one are refilled. Leave the loading bay clear for their equipment van. Overnight access to the prep corridor requires the pass code below.

badge for bajop-yawep: bdg-NNHEW-6